[–] DmMacniel@feddit.org 23 points 1 day ago* (last edited 1 day ago) (12 children)

They don't, since the pencil is too thin (using your pinky has the same effect). Use a bic pen or a german/japanese pencil and then you can rewound the tape proper.

[–] disguy_ovahea@lemmy.world 6 points 23 hours ago (1 children)

Nah. You don’t want it to rotate, you want to move your hand in a small circle.

You use the wood right before the exposed lead and maintain pressure toward the outside of the spool. The pen clip cap from a Bic or a partially unbent paper clip worked even better than a pencil.

Source: excessive Phish bootlegging in the 90s
